Handover — Report Builder Sort Stability (Tollgate project)

For on-call: the Ledgerline report builder's sort became unstable after the comparator refactor; tied rows now shuffle between runs. A hotfix pinning the tiebreaker column is staged. If you need to deploy it, the release vault prompts for operator confirmation. Enter the recovery passphrase below.

recovery phrase for fajeg-hagug: holox-fenmir

## Tuning

The Gatewick turnstile counter batches tap events before flushing to the Crowdledger backend. If counts lag during peak ingress at Harrowfield Arena, shrink the flush interval before touching batch size. Oversized batches cause timeout storms; undersized ones hammer the network. Restart the collector after any change. On-call should treat the following constants as the safe operating envelope.

constants for tafog-kahag:
RATE_LIMITS = {
    "sorir": 697,
    "oliox": 683,
    "holax": 176,
    "casox": 60,
    "pelius": 382,
}

**Mgmt Meeting Minutes — Retiring the Brightline Range**

Quick recap for sales leads at Fenholt Supplies: we agreed to retire the Brightline fixture range by year-end. Remaining stock moves to clearance pricing next month, and accounts on standing orders get migrated to the Lumetta range. Trade-in incentives were approved in principle. The confidential note on next steps sits just below.

board note of bajof-bajeg: The pricing group signed off on a budget of $13.4 million for Project Sildor. The renewal with Lamixek Holdings closes at $48.9 million a year, 49 percent above the last contract.

Capacity note for the Mossgrain test-data factory: generating nested fixtures at current defaults peaks around 2 GB heap per worker in CI. Batch size and pool reuse dominate. Don't raise fixture depth without re-running the Bramwick load sweep. Reviewer: please sanity-check the limits below against staging. Current constants follow.

tuning table, hafog-bahaf:
QUOTAS = {
    "praion": 144,
    "briax": 906,
    "silwyn": 451,
}